    Found this Antique Bronze Lamp Base today. Am interested in identifying what it may be. Also would like to know what a complete lamp with the correct original shade would look like. Measures: H. 18-1/2 " x W. 10". It has 3-Hubble acorn pull chain sockets at top. A Column Mid section with what appears to be a man recessed in the column and a reptile with another critter in its mouth crawling up the same side. It has three Gargoyle Head legs that have claw feet. There are no other markings that I can find. There is no shade with it. A Bronze base only. I can take more photos if needed. Any help with Identifying the maker will be Gratefully Appreciated. Thank you.
